We hear a lot about 7 bolts crankwalking, lets see for interest how many 1g's have crankwalked. May be interesting :rolleyes:

Note... According to Conicelli Mitsubishi cars built between March 1989 and the third week of april 1992 have 6 bolts.
 
i thought it was the 3rd week of may when the 6bolts were manafactured till..? i don't think anyone here is going to tell you that their 6 bolt walked,but any engine can get crank walk,well.. anything short of a wankel,but even then the eccentric shaft could walk although i don't see that posing any serious problems.

This isn't exactly a scientific method of polling. Its more like a couple guys on the internet. Let's not jump to conclusions.
 
I honestly think that Crankwalk is the easy target to blame for a messed up motor.

Most of the DSM guys I personally know that "think" they have crankwalk don't and in fact it ends up being something else that gets fixed.

Like it was stated before any motor can crankwalk and until the guys who claim that they crankwalked show any proof, the numbers are just that.
